It's just cold :)

Not to worry, many primers freeze in low temperatures. Just let it sit until it's room temp, or put the bottle to stand in some warm water.

You can't save the brush now, so maybe dip a spare brush into the bottle to use once it's liquid again.

In future, check it's not solid before opening so you don't damage the brush, and then let it warm up before use x
 
It's just frozen.:. Every single morning in our shop I deal with this [emoji85].

If you need it ASAP, sitting it in a cup of warm water will melt it enough to use.
